So I know a bit of Teeline which is a nice shorthand where you (mostly) write regular English but with different letterforms. But I've just learned about Pitman shorthand which is a) phonetic b) requires you to vary the thickness of the lines!? This looks like it was made to torture journalists.
Anyway, apparently this used to be one of the applications for fountain pens with flex nibs
